Sebastian Vettel Q&A: Qualifying strategy taken with race in mind

It may be unusual to see perennial polesitter Sebastian Vettel back in ninth on the grid but Vettel for one isn’t worried. The Red Bull driver believes the team’s decision to stay on the mediums in Q3 will pay off on race day. The young German discusses the team’s qualifying gamble…Q: Sebastian, you didn’t even try to take part in the fight for pole position. Was that an intentional decision or a forced one after you locked up?Sebastian Vettel: I have no idea why I locked up. Suddenly there was no pressure and the pedal became very long.
